Visual Studio 2019 apporte un nouvel éditeur de code sur Mac

Stéphane Moussie |

Microsoft a publié sur Windows et Mac la version finale de Visual Studio 2019, son environnement de développement C# qui permet de créer des applications Android, iOS, macOS, web et cloud. La version Mac bénéficie d'un nouvel éditeur de code qui partage la même base que la mouture Windows tout en étant adapté à l'interface de macOS. Ce nouvel éditeur est censé être plus performant et il dispose de l'autocomplétion IntelliSense.

Pour l'heure, il gère seulement les fichiers C#, mais la prise en charge d'autres langages est prévue pour plus tard. Puisqu'il n'est pas encore complet, ce nouvel éditeur n'est pas proposé par défaut, il faut l'activer dans les préférences s'il vous intéresse.

Visual Studio 2019 améliore la gestion globale des projets. Une nouvelle fenêtre de démarrage permet de créer un nouveau projet et d'en chercher un existant. Il est dorénavant possible d'ouvrir plusieurs instances de l'IDE pour travailler sur plusieurs projets à la fois.

De nombreux outils ont été optimisés. La compilation et le déploiement avec Xamarin, qui permet de créer des apps Android, sont plus rapides, par exemple. La liste complète des changements de la version Mac est consultable ici. Visual Studio 2019 est gratuit et demande macOS Sierra au minimum.

avatar iPop | 

Le même sur iOS serait une bonne chose.

avatar ultrabill | 

Ce qui mettrait à mal le modèle économique d'Apple : macOS pour créer, iOS pour consulter.

Et entre nous, ça mettrait à genoux un iPad (/Pro) et boufferait vite le peu de place disponible, tu ne trouves pas ?

avatar iPop | 

@ultrabill

1. Microsoft: Kesnanafout !
2. maintenant tout est dans le cloud

avatar ultrabill | 

Je ne retiens que le 2nd argument :D Ça fait sens.

avatar oomu | 

"Ce qui mettrait à mal le modèle économique d'Apple : macOS pour créer, iOS pour consulter."

Apple a jamais restreint l'ipad à la "consultation"

et régulièrement les pubs d'Apple présentent l'ipad comme outil de création (garageband, iwork, des montages, etc)

Ce modèle économique n'existe pas.

Y a juste Apple qui dit des trucs ("achetez tout, tout sert à tout") mais ne s'en donne pas les moyens.

avatar ultrabill | 

J'entendais dans "créer" dans le sens de "développer son environnement". On parle, dans cette actu, de VS Code ;) iOS ne fonctionne pas en vase clôt, pour lui donner à manger il te faut un Mac.
Quand XCode sera porté sur iOS, avec possibilité de compiler/déployer tes apps sur ton appareil, (ou un autre), on aura passé une étape importante dans l'autonomie d'iOS.

Ainsi, pour faire une app iOS t'as toujours besoin du Mac. Modèle économique ? Impossibilité techniques ? Mauvaise expérience ? Aucun besoin exprimé par les devs ? Ou autre...

avatar marc_os | 

« Il est dorénavant possible d'ouvrir plusieurs instances de l'IDE pour travailler sur plusieurs projets à la fois. »
Ça c'est du Windows tout craché !
Sur Mac, un logiciel peut normalement ouvrir plusieurs fenêtres.
Comme Xcode qui permet d'ouvrir plusieurs projets avec une fenêtre par projet.
Je suppose donc que leur truc ne sait pas gérer des projets contenant plusieurs sous-projets comme Xcode, s'il leur faut plusieurs "instances" pour gérer plusieurs projets !
Ce que je trouve également curieux, c'est qu'on puisse trouver ça tellement super que ça fasse partie des fonctions relevées dans l'article...

avatar destouma | 

« Il est dorénavant possible d'ouvrir plusieurs instances de l'IDE pour travailler sur plusieurs projets à la fois. »
C'est clair que c'était pénible...

avatar oomu | 

"Ça c'est du Windows tout craché !"

oui, bien vu.

avatar vince29 | 

Mais faux. Depuis le début il est possible de lancer plusieurs instances de VS pour travailler sur plusieurs projets.
A la limite tu pourrais avoir des soucis avec ton paramétrage (est-ce que l'option modifiée est enregistrée immédiatement ou bien a la sortie de la dernière instance) mais c'est tout.
Ou alors je suis complètement passé à côté de ce que l'auteur voulait dire.

avatar Achylle_ | 

Ce serait effectivement un super test de perf pour l’iPad pro que de pouvoir compiler sur iOS.
Mais pas si sûr qu’il soit à genoux si facilement le bestiau.

A quand un IDE sur iOS !! Un Xcode ou un visualstudio, voir un Eclipse...

avatar oomu | 

eclipse ?!

je pourrai y instancier mon serveur applicatifs d'EJB ?

avatar deodorant | 

Même si c’est Microsoft, l’éditeur de code Visual Studio Code gratuit est l’un des meilleurs. Au point que je ne vois pas l’interêt de payer des logiciels comme coda. Je ne connais l’IDE mais ça donne envie ... non, tout n’est pas à jeter chez Microsoft n’en déplaise aux trolls. Leur logiciel de notes gratuit est top aussi!

avatar LoossSS | 

Ne t'inquiète pas et laisse parler les gens qui émettent des avis sans rien n'y connaître...
Visual studio code est un des projets les plus suivis sur GitHub. Visual studio community est parfait quand on a des besoins plus sérieux. Et visual studio (pro etc. (sur Windows)) est utilisé par des milliers (millions ?) de développeurs / entreprises etc qui n'ont pas grand chose à lui reprocher car il est très, très loin devant.
Mais oui, c'est Microsoft alors c'est de la merde probablement...

avatar Woaha | 

@deodorant

Microsoft fait toujours de très bonnes app iOS et mac je trouve. Comme office Lens.

CONNEXION UTILISATEUR